Public access to the Flint Pen Strand Unit of the Corkscrew Regional Watershed Ecosystem (CREW) in Lee and Collier Counties will re-open today, Friday, April 8, at 5 p.m. Public access was temporarily closed due to wildfires.
A temporary burn ban remains in place on SFWMD lands in Lee, Collier and Hendry Counties due to dry conditions.
